The Registration Coordinator position provides medical office support including check-in and some check out functions. Manage the reception of patients within the office and by telephone. Obtains patient insurance and demographic information, collects co-pays, payments, and schedules internal appointments, etc.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Answers the telephones and greets patients in a courteous, efficient manner. Routes calls/messages to appropriate discipline/department
  • Follows policy and procedures outlined by management to ensure standardization of processes across all clinics
  • Conducts patient check-in, following policy and procedures
  • Properly tracks patients in EHR for next location and ensures patients are not missed
  • Obtains pre-patient registration, demographic and insurance information and enters appropriately into Patient Management System (PM) or Electronic Health Record (EHR). Including all paper/electronic documents
    • Verify and update patient demographics
    • Scan documents into Electronic Health Record
    • Collect patient photographs, scan insurance cards (and notify insurance auth coordinators), and documents/obtains signatures on necessary forms as needed
  • Ensures eligible patients have proper distress screening
  • Collects co-payments and/or payments at time of service and manages end of day procedure to include daily deposit, petty cash reconciliation, and sign in sheets
  • Ensures canceled/no show and missed appointments are followed up and properly documented
  • Schedules internal patient appointments and makes walk-in appointments, i.e. Nurse triage, sample drop off, etc.
  • Communicates information regarding Patient Engagement Portal and assists with registration process, to include sending invites
  • Runs and works daily reports, such as cancel/no show, missing employer, etc.
  • Demonstrates excellent customer service. Responds promptly to patient, physician, manager, clinic, and other department requests
  • Communicates to other staff members using Instant Messaging System
  • Scans documents into Electronic Health Record
  • Other duties as assigned
  • Ability to travel/float to other clinics for business needs
  • Maintain and ensure confidentiality of patient information
  • Adheres to all Tennessee Oncology policies and procedures

About Tennessee Oncology

Tennessee Oncology is one of the nation’s largest community-based cancer care specialists and home to one of the leading clinical trial networks in the country.

Established 1976 in Nashville, Tennessee Oncology’s mission remains unchanged: To provide access to high quality cancer care and the expertise of clinical research for all patients at convenient locations within their community and close to their home. To this day, our growing network of physicians and number of locations is based on this mission. In 2018, Tennessee Oncology joined OneOncology, a partnership of oncologists and industry leading experts driving the future of community-based cancer care in the United States, as a founding practice partner.

Physicians specializing in gynecologic oncology, palliative care, radiation oncology, and health psychology comprise our group.

Tennessee Oncology provides a full range of diagnostic services, including oncology specific expertise in PET/CT and laboratory services. Clinic locations provide on-site chemotherapy treatments so that patients receive care in their community and close to their home.

Our physicians utilize the latest in molecular diagnostics and profiling to choose treatments specific to the genetics of your cancer.

Oncology research is the largest area of new drug development. Self -administered medications, those taken by mouth or injected by the patient, comprise approximately 40% of these investigative medications. Tennessee Oncology’s in house pharmacy, Park Pharmacy, stocks oncology and hematology medications not readily available at community retail pharmacies. A URAC accredited Specialty Pharmacy, Park provides insurance and benefits investigation, prior authorization services for insurance coverage, co-pay assistance through manufacturer or foundation programs, extensive medication education, and access to a pharmacist 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.
